Always call 999 in the event of a life-threatening emergency.
​
The call handler may ask you to send someone to retrieve a Public Access Defibrillator (PAD) if there is one nearby and will provide the access code to open the cabinet, while talking you through CPR instruction to help give the casualty the best chance of survival and deploying essential medical backup (CFR/Rapid Response Vehicle/Ambulance Crew/HART/Air Ambulance).
